TheImportanceofCFULevelsinReverseOsmosisWaterSystems
ColonyFormingUnits(CFUs)measurethenumberofviablebacteriaormicrobialcellsinagivenvolumeofwater.Forimplantwashing,maintaininganappropriateCFUcountisessentialbecauseexcessivebacteriacanintroduceinfectionsorcomplicationsduringtheprocedure.
Reverseosmosis(RO)watersystemsarewidelyusedtoreducecontaminants,includingmicrobes,fromwaterbyforcingitthroughasemipermeablemembrane.However,theeffectivenessofROsystemsinloweringCFUsdependsonsystemdesign,maintenance,andadditionaldisinfectionsteps.
HowManyCFUsAreAppropriateforImplantWashing?
Whenwashingimplants,watershouldhaveextremelylowmicrobialcontamination.Generally,waterusedinmedicalanddentalimplantcleaningshouldhaveCFUlevelsclosetozeroorbelow1CFUpermillilitertominimizeinfectionrisk.Thisstandardensuresthatthewaterisessentiallyfreefromharmfulbacteriathatcouldcompromiseimplantintegrityorpatienthealth.
